I've been using GD for over a year now and it really is a great app. My favorite music player, really. Congrats anonbeat.

Still when I play a FLAC album, GD almost always, plays some songs and randomly skips others. In earlier releases, there was a gstreamer error reported when this happened, but now (Guayadeque 3.1, Ubuntu 10.04) it just skips a random song or two songs and continues playing.

Try disabling lyrics target Embed to audio files. I will make a fix of this problem soon.
